Annovis Bio Director Buys $160K in Stock, Boosts Holdings

Company: Annovis Bio, Inc. (ANVS) Form: 4 | Filed: 2025-11-25 Significance: Medium

Insider: Hoffman Michael B Title: null | Relationship: Director

Transaction: • Type: Buy • Shares: 39,200 • Avg. Price: $4.08 • Value: $159,890 • Owned After: 2,743,096 (14.1% of company)

Key Insight: A director significantly increased their already substantial stake, reinforcing conviction in the company. The purchase, while moderate in size relative to market cap, pushes the insider's total ownership to over 14% of all outstanding shares.

Market Context: This purchase occurs in a small-cap biotech company, where insider conviction can be a notable signal to the market.

Additional Context

Transaction Notes

  • The purchase was conducted through four separate transactions on the same day at prices ranging from $3.85 to $4.15.
  • The insider holds shares both directly (2,519,739) and indirectly through a family trust (223,357).
